Matter of James

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, Second Department
Feb 18, 1941
261 App. Div. 925 (N.Y. App. Div. 1941)

Opinion

February 18, 1941.

Present — Lazansky, P.J., Hagarty, Carswell, Johnston and Close, JJ.


Decree of the Surrogate's Court, Putnam County, admitting to probate the will of decedent and a codicil thereto, unanimously affirmed, with costs to each party filing a brief, payable out of the estate. No opinion.
